i have a code like this :
String hex = String.format("0x%02x%02x%02x", r * 0.5, green * 0.6, blue * 0.7));
0.5 and 0.6 and 0.7 are variables and i want to set background color of a view from variable hex :
v.setBackgroundColor(Integer.parseInt(hex, 16));
When i try to convert it to Hexadecimal integer it throws exceptions like
java.lang.NumberFormatException
how can i do this?
